Regardless of emergency assist from Shohei Ohtani, Dodgers lose once more: ‘Actually haven’t any solutions’

BALTIMORE — In a single nook of the room, Tanner Scott stared blankly into his locker, attempting to come back to grips with one more recreation he let get away.

Throughout from him, Dalton Dashing propped a pair of crutches below his arms, limping out of sight with the Dodgers’ newest harm.

On the other wall, Freddie Freeman received dressed at his stall; taking within the somber scene within the visiting clubhouse at Camden Yards, whereas attempting to consider precisely what to say concerning the group’s troubling, tumbling, torturous present play.

“Sometimes, you just don’t have the right answers,” Freeman mentioned, as reporters gathered round for a well-recognized line of questions. “Not going to sit here and give some cliches. We’re just not playing very good. … There’s no sugarcoating this. We need to figure this out, and figure this out quick.”

Certainly, simply when the Dodgers’ second-half stoop appeared prefer it couldn’t get any worse, Friday delivered a brand new set of complications.

Scheduled beginning pitcher Tyler Glasnow was scratched within the afternoon with again tightness, forcing Shohei Ohtani to pitch on simply 5 hours’ discover.

Dashing exited early after fouling a ball painfully off his proper shin, leaving the Dodgers with out each their beginning backstop (Will Smith stays sidelined with a bone bruise on his hand) or his backup (X-rays on Dashing’s leg have been detrimental, however he may even want a CT scan) for at the very least the following few days.

After which, after all, there was the sport: A 2-1 walk-off loss to the last-place Baltimore Orioles that despatched the slumping Dodgers to a fourth straight defeat.

“We can sit here after every game and talk about what we need to do,” Freeman mentioned. “It’s just, we got to do it.”

Friday went off the rails earlier than the Dodgers (78-63) even arrived on the ballpark, beginning with a flurry of cellphone calls to determine their pitching.

Abruptly, Dodgers coaches, staffers and front-office officers in Baltimore and in Los Angeles started what pitching coach Mark Prior described as a “game of telephone” — attempting to determine what to do about Glasnow, and who may pitch if he have been unable.

“There was a lot of moving parts,” Prior quipped.

Finally, the group determined to scratch Glasnow, choosing a cautious method to what they hope is simply a minor subject. In accordance with supervisor Dave Roberts, the tentative plan is to fit Glasnow again into the rotation early subsequent week. However given his harm historical past, questions will linger till he’s really again on the hill.

Within the meantime, the group needed to determine who to ship to the mound on Friday. At round 2 p.m., the request went to Ohtani — who had been scratched from a scheduled pitching begin Wednesday in Pittsburgh whereas battling an sickness, however had improved sufficient to oblige the short-notice request.

“It’s gonna be OK,” Freeman joked as he adopted Ohtani into the visiting clubhouse at Camden Yards just a few hours later. “The unicorn is here.”

Ohtani did his half in what was an abbreviated outing by design, delivering 3⅔ scoreless innings with 5 strikeouts and three hits given up.

However, of their newest dispiriting efficiency, the Dodgers couldn’t make it matter, going silent on the plate once more earlier than struggling one more late-game meltdown.

“I know each day the guys come in fresh, prepared and expecting a different result,” Roberts mentioned. “But we’re just not getting it done.”

Offensively, the Dodgers struggled to generate possibilities, or capitalize upon the few they did. Baltimore starter Dean Kremer retired his first eight batters, together with first-inning fly balls from Mookie Betts and Freeman that died on the wall. When the Dodgers did create alternatives within the third (getting two aboard with two outs) and the fourth (loading the bases with two outs) they got here up empty; persevering with an inexplicable slide by which they’ve ranked twenty seventh within the majors in scoring over their final 53 video games.

“We individually are trying to find ways on our own to … [be] hitting better than we are,” Ohtani, who managed solely a stroll in 4 journeys to the plate, mentioned by way of interpreter Will Ireton. “But I think the side effect of that is, we’re a little too eager, and putting too much pressure on ourselves. That’s really hurting us more than it’s helping.”

On the mound, in the meantime, Ohtani managed to put up zeros, navigating the Orioles (65-76) with a fastball that touched 101.5 mph and a various combine that helped induce 12 swing-and-misses.

However as quickly as he exited — pulled after 70 pitches given the rushed leadup to his begin — the Dodgers shortly fell behind on a obtrusive defensive lapse.

Within the fifth, the Orioles drew a pair of walks. Then, with lead runner Jackson Holliday breaking for third, a sweeper within the dust received previous Dashing — the fifth wild pitch he allowed within the final two video games filling in for Smith.

Holliday turned for residence as Dashing scrambled to the backstop. By the point Dashing threw to the plate, Holliday was already sliding in safely for the primary run of the sport.

The Dodgers’ deficit didn’t final for lengthy. On the primary pitch of the sixth, Freeman whacked one other fly ball that carried deep sufficient to get out, his nineteenth residence run of the season tying the rating 1-1.

However then, extra frustration adopted — with the Dodgers leaving two runners stranded later in that inning, when Dashing was compelled to exit together with his harm; then one other within the seventh, when Freeman grounded out following a two-out double from Betts.

“Not scoring runs, it’s just not who we are,” Freeman mentioned. “We’re not getting anything going. We’re not getting the hits.”

“We haven’t for a while,” he added. “I truly have no answers.”

Neither, it seems, does Scott, the already embattled nearer who suffered his newest calamity within the ninth.

After getting the primary two outs, the left-hander made the identical form of mistake that has haunted him all season, leaving a 1-and-2 fastball proper down the center to Samuel Basallo that the Orioles catcher clobbered for a no-doubt, successful blast deep to right-center area.

“I just keep making terrible pitch selections right when it matters, and it’s costing us every time,” mentioned Scott, who has a 4.52 ERA and 11 mixed blown saves and charged losses. “It sucks. It feels terrible. And I have to figure it out. Because baseball hates me right now.”

These days, it hasn’t been extra relenting on the Dodgers as a complete, both — dealing them painful losses and crippling accidents amid a continued seek for any shred of improved play.

“We all are confident in who we are as baseball players. We’re just not doing it right now in the field,” Freeman mentioned, because the gloomy postgame clubhouse surrounding him mirrored the anguished state of the group. “The game of baseball’s really hard, but the concept is easy. We’re making the concept really hard right now.”
